3 Steps To Start & Grow A Church Youth Group. 1. Do Fun Stuff Together (Reach) Getting new faces into your group is your starting point. Though I could give you a whole list of evangelism ideas, by far the most effective way of getting new people into the group is for your existing members to invite them. Feeling marginal, adolescents join gangs for social relationships that give them a sense of identity (Vigil and Long, 1990). For some youth, gangs provide a way of solving social adjustment problems, particularly the trials and tribulations of adolescence (Short and Strodtbeck, 1965). Youth organizing connects to virtually all social justice sectors. The issue areas that are taken-up by youth organizing groups are the same ones that are worked on by labor and environmental groups, criminal justice organizing groups, and educational justice group, to name a few.
